
Calling All Disabled Supporters
Created on Monday, 21 November 2011
MK Dons and the Milton Keynes Dons Supporters Association are looking for a number of disabled supporters who would be prepared to attend a get together in the stadium boardroom.A researcher from the University of Staffordshire would like to interview the group to get their personal experiences of attending football matches.
The event will take place at 6.30pm on Thursday 8th December in the Level 3 Boardroom at Stadium MK. The interview will take around an hour to complete, with the interviewer setting the theme and discussions then leading on from your own experiences.

On 23rd October 2003, thirty fans met at the National Hockey Stadium in Milton Keynes to establish a new supporters association following the arrival of Wimbledon Football Club (now renamed Milton Keynes Dons FC), from their former home at Selhurst Park in South London. A number of people volunteered to undertake roles as part of a steering committee to lead the association during its formation stages. In May 2004, the first full Annual General Meeting was held and Officers were elected by it's members
